Sinopse

In "Beside Still Waters," Arthur Christopher Benson crafts a reflective exploration of the human experience, delving into the themes of nature, solitude, and introspection. The book unfolds through a series of essay-like meditations, rich with lyrical prose and evocative imagery, reflecting the tranquillity of countryside life. Benson's stylistic approach, deeply rooted in the late Victorian literary tradition, embodies a profound appreciation for the natural world, echoing the influence of contemporaries such as John Clare and Thomas Hardy. The work resonates with readers seeking solace in literature that interlaces philosophical musings with the serene backdrop of nature's beauty. Arthur Christopher Benson, renowned for his literary pursuits and as the author of the iconic "Declaration of a Truth-Seeker," had a fervent interest in the spirituality and simplicity of life. His upbringing in the picturesque English countryside and his intimate connection to the natural world undoubtedly informed his writing. As a modern thinker who explored themes of faith and existence, Benson draws readers into his contemplative world, making them ponder the deeper meanings of their own lives.     Set in a revolutionary era of physics and science when a series of rapid-fire discoveries was upending our understanding of the universe, Splinters of Infinity by Mark Wolverton tells a little-known story: the tale of two of America's foremost physicists, Robert Millikan (1868–1953) and Arthur Compton (1892–1962), who found themselves locked in an intense, often deeply personal, conflict about cosmic rays. Confirmed in 1912, cosmic rays—enigmatic forms of penetrating radiation—seemed to raise all new questions about the origins of the universe, but they also offered the potential to explain everything—or reveal the existence of God. 
     
     
     
    In engaging, accessible prose, Wolverton takes the listener through the twists and turns of the Millikan-Compton debate, one of the first major public examples of how heated the controversies among scientists could become—and the lengths that scientists would go to settle their disputes. Along the way, Wolverton probes the forever elusive question, still unanswered today, about where cosmic rays come from and what they reveal about black holes, distant galaxies, the existence of dark matter and dark energy, and the birth of the universe, concluding that these splinters of infinity may not hold the keys to the secret of creation but do bring us ever closer to it.

    Mountains are among the most awe-inspiring features of the Earth's landscape, rising as towering peaks that shape weather patterns, influence ecosystems, and define the natural borders of continents. Their formation is a complex process driven by immense geological forces acting over millions of years. The primary mechanisms behind mountain building include tectonic activity, volcanic processes, and the gradual effects of erosion and uplift. 
    One of the most significant processes responsible for mountain formation is tectonic activity, particularly through folding and faulting. The Earth's crust is divided into massive plates that float atop the semi-molten mantle. When these plates collide, the immense pressure causes the crust to buckle and fold, resulting in the formation of fold mountains such as the Himalayas and the Alps. These ranges continue to rise as the plates press against each other, making them some of the youngest and most geologically active mountains in the world. Fault-block mountains, on the other hand, form when tectonic forces cause large sections of the Earth's crust to break and shift along faults. The Sierra Nevada in North America is an example of a fault-block mountain range created by the movement of these fractured rock masses. 
    Another major contributor to mountain formation is volcanic activity. When magma from beneath the Earth's surface erupts through cracks in the crust, it cools and solidifies, gradually building up into towering volcanic mountains. Over successive eruptions, these formations can grow into massive peaks such as Mount Fuji in Japan or Mount Kilimanjaro in Africa.
